Sourcing guidance for Stainless Tool Chest
What are the key material specifications to consider when selecting a stainless tool chest?
The most critical factor is the grade of stainless steel used. Grade 304 is the industry standard for superior corrosion resistance and durability, especially in humid or coastal environments. Grade 430 is a more cost-effective alternative but is magnetic and less resistant to rust. Ensure the gauge thickness is at least 18 to 20 gauge for the body and 14 to 16 gauge for the frame to prevent warping under heavy tool loads.
How do I evaluate the load capacity and mechanical performance of the drawers?
Check for heavy-duty ball-bearing slides with a rated capacity of at least 100 lbs (45kg) per drawer. For larger bottom drawers intended for power tools, look for double-slide configurations that can handle 200 lbs or more. Additionally, ensure the drawers feature a self-closing or 'stay-shut' mechanism to prevent accidental opening during movement.
What compliance and safety standards should a professional-grade tool chest meet?
For the North American market, look for ANSI/BIFMA standards for durability and safety. If the unit includes integrated power strips or USB ports, they must be UL or ETL certified to ensure electrical safety. For European markets, CE marking and GS certification are essential indicators of mechanical safety and quality control.
What mobility and structural features are necessary for industrial use?
The chest should be equipped with heavy-duty polyurethane casters (typically 5x2 inches) with a total load rating exceeding the chest's maximum capacity. At least two casters must have locking swivels. Look for tubular stainless steel side handles that are bolted through the frame rather than just riveted, ensuring they can withstand the force of a fully loaded cabinet.
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Stainless Tool Chests
How can I mitigate the risk of damage during international shipping?
Stainless steel is prone to denting and scratching. Insist on ISTA 3A or 6-Amazon.com packaging standards, which include reinforced honeycomb corner protectors, double-wall corrugated boxes, and a wooden pallet base. Request that the supplier applies a protective PE film on all stainless surfaces to prevent abrasions during assembly and transit.

How do I verify the quality of the stainless steel remotely?
Request a Material Test Report (MTR) or a Mill Test Certificate to verify the chemical composition (Nickel and Chromium levels). You can also hire a third-party inspection service to perform a salt spray test (typically 24-72 hours) or a spot chemical test during the pre-shipment inspection to confirm it is truly Grade 304 and not a lower-quality alloy.
What are the shipping and logistics considerations for such heavy items?
Due to the high weight-to-volume ratio, LCL (Less than Container Load) shipping can be expensive due to 'heavy cargo' surcharges. It is often more economical to ship via FCL (Full Container Load). Ensure the supplier uses fumigated wooden pallets or plastic pallets to comply with international ISPM 15 standards to avoid customs delays.
